Material Options and Specifications
Choosing the right material is key for CNC projects. There are many options, each with its own benefits. For metals, aluminum, steel, and copper are top picks because they’re strong and versatile. These metals work well for a variety of CNC projects, from simple parts to complex machinery.
For lighter and more flexible needs, plastic and composite materials are great. They can be molded into complex shapes. These materials are often used in aerospace, automotive, and medical fields. Precision and Tolerance Standards
In CNC manufacturing, precision and tolerance are key. Precision is how well a machine makes parts. Tolerance is how much a part can vary in size. Meeting these standards is crucial for quality products.
CNC machines use computers to cut and shape materials with great precision. To get this precision, manufacturers follow strict standards. They calibrate machines often and train operators well. This way, they make parts that fit exact specifications.

Accepted File Formats
- STEP
- IGES
- STL
- DWG
- DXF
File Size Requirements
We suggest keeping your file sizes under 50MB for easy uploading and processing. If you have bigger files, reach out to our support team for help.

Industry-Specific Applications
CNC manufacturing is used in many fields, like automotive parts, aerospace components, and medical devices. These areas need precision and accuracy, making CNC a perfect fit. It can create complex shapes and designs with great accuracy, which is vital for these industries.
Some key uses of CNC manufacturing include:
- Automotive parts: It makes engine components, transmission parts, and suspension systems.
- Aerospace components: It creates complex parts for aircraft engines, satellites, and spacecraft.
- Medical devices: It produces surgical tools, implants, and diagnostic equipment.
